Searcy, AR (LP) — How humans manage time around is so complicated especially when they have something that takes up eight hours of your day. Students have to deal with this five days out of the week. How students manage time is different between all. But if not managed right they seem to all have the same outcome. Many students have to learn to manage time when coming to a high school. With sports, school, work, family, friends, Ect. If time is not managed correctly you can have a bad outcome, such as dropping grades, not being able to play in sports, not getting to spend time with family or friends because you need to catch up. So how do teens manage their time?

Seeing how students manage their time, a former student here at Searcy High School Brayden Cook manages his time well. “ I try to spread it out evenly between things like work,schools, and friends.” A good time management can keep you and your mind set organized and focused. “ I try and get it all done but I can’t because I don’t know the answers and trying to find the answers and trying to do it at the last second takes more time because my stress level gets high which slows me down.” When you can’t finish homework in class, teachers will assign it as homework. When work is not completed students will have to either go and do the work in another class or do it after school when they possibly don’t have any time if they have to work or go do something else after school.” When work is not completed in class it makes time very difficult to move around because you don’t know when you can get that work done. Michael Shourd is a student known to keep his time organized and work caught up. “If work is not done in class it makes it more stressful and frustrating because you go to the next class and you just stress out about when you can finish the rest of your work which just stresses from that you stress more and fall behind in that class. So once you fall behind a little you just keep falling behind more and more.” Students have noticed that when you fall behind on one thing your stress level will go out of control and you will  just keep falling behind until you finally catch up. So managing time for students is the best way for them to stay out of a stressful situation.
